What is a Sash Window?
Before diving into the specifics of sash window specialists, it is vital to understand what sash windows are. Sash Window Refurbishment Cost windows are framed windows that include several movable panels, called sashes, which hold the glass. These windows operate by sliding vertically or horizontally and have been utilized in different architectural designs given that the 17th century.

Understanding the repair procedure can assist property owners appreciate the work included and the knowledge needed. Below is a typical series of actions that Experienced Sash Window Technicians (Pads.Jeito.Nl) follow throughout remediation.
Assessment: Technicians start with an extensive evaluation to assess the condition of the windows.Taking apart: Careful dismantling of the sashes is important to assess each component’s state.Repairing or Replacing Components: Any damaged parts, including the frame, glass, or hardware, are either repaired or replaced.Draught Proofing: Weather removing or other materials are added to decrease drafts.Repainting and Finishing: Finally, the windows are repainted or refinished to make sure defense against the elements and improve appearance.Frequently Asked Question About Sash Window Technicians
1. How do I understand if my sash windows require repair work?

Indications consist of difficulty opening or closing the sashes, noticeable decay or damage to the wood, drafts, or condensation between the panes of glass.

3. Can I repair sash windows myself?

While minor upkeep jobs might be workable for a DIY enthusiast, substantial repairs and remediations require professional knowledge to make sure durability and visual fidelity.

4. How typically should sash windows be serviced?

It is advised to have Sash Window Repairs Near Me windows inspected every few years, particularly for older homes, to resolve concerns before they escalate.

5. What materials do sash window technicians generally use?

Professionals typically utilize standard materials like hardwood for frames and contemporary choices such as double-glazed glass for enhanced insulation.
